Active Contours with Group Similarity [PDF]

open access: yes2013 IEEE Conference on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, 2013
Active contours are widely used in image segmentation. To cope with missing or misleading features in images, researchers have introduced various ways to model the prior of shapes and use the prior to constrain active contours. However, the shape prior is usually learnt from a large set of annotated data, which is not always accessible in practice ...

LBP-guided active contours [PDF]

open access: yesPattern Recognition Letters, 2008
This paper investigates novel LBP-guided active contour approaches to texture segmentation. The local binary pattern (LBP) operator is well suited for texture representation, combining efficiency and effectiveness for a variety of applications. In this light, two LBP-guided active contours have been formulated, namely the scalar-LBP active contour (s ...
